1. Get everything you need for a professional listing from the team at List Logix
If you want a team of real estate photographers and videographers specializing in “bringing real estate to life,” then you want to work with List Logix. Working with both residential and commercial properties throughout Phoenix, they have a full list of services. Their photographers are all experienced pros who are backed by a professional post-production team hand-selecting and editing your photos to perfection. This team knows how to emphasize and obscure certain areas of the home for the most appealing photos.
Plus, their walkthrough and promotional videos have a cinematic feel. This helps viewers feel like they’re within the space and connect with it all before setting foot in it. Perhaps just as important as getting your property sold is getting yourself noticed as a realtor. And List Logix handles that, too, creating a full range of marketing materials to help you stand out. Their videos have been shared on social media thousands of times — making them marketing and photography experts.
2. Show off your space from its best angles when you book a shoot with Mark Nelson
Mark Nelson has years of experience as a wedding photographer. This transfers to real estate since he spent a large portion of time making the venues and the couples look their once-in-a-lifetime best. He has taken that experience into his current career as a Phoenix real estate photographer — helping both homes and the realtors who sell them look wonderful.
Mark offers plenty of photography packages like drone stills and video, twilight shoots, video walkthroughs, and Matterport 3D imaging. He also offers headshot services to realtors and other professionals. His portrait style has been refined by his years of experience and he knows all about using flash and ambient lighting for portraits that are polished and powerful. He’s one of our favorites for the diversity of his skills and just how good he helps his subjects look.

3. Ensure swoon-worthy images when you team up with Phoenix Real Estate Photography
Mike Small has been serving all of the Phoenix and Scottsdale areas with his polished real estate photos for over 10 years. And in those 10 years, he has photographed over 18,000 properties! As a dedicated real estate specialist, he will give your property the attention it deserves. In fact, his specialty is using angles and subtle editing to accentuate the flow of your space.
Mike also knows what kinds of details will help drive interest and get you showings. Regularly keeping his equipment up to date, he currently offers Matterport 3D home tours. Since he also endeavors to keep his style current, he offers add-ons growing in demand including neighborhood introductory photos and twilight shoots.
4. Procure magazine-worthy photos of your space from JMB Photography
A multi-talented creative, Josh caught our eye with his editorial style work. With a thriving studio making an array of commercial work encompassing food, fashion, and real estate, his eye is always trained on what sells. As a Phoenix and Scottsdale real estate photographer, he knows finely crafted shots that allow the viewer to envision their life within those walls are key.
He has a light editing touch, tending to keep shadows bright for a sense of spaciousness but keeping it realistic and balanced. Josh’s eye is particularly well suited for luxury homes — amping up their glamour factor with careful compositions and an emphasis on space.
5. Get everything you want when you work with pros like Snap2Close
The name of this studio says it all — snap to close. With thousands of properties photographed, the experts here know how to feature your listing to its best advantage. They offer a complete range of services including Matterport 3D tours, Zillow home tours, drone packages, virtual twilight, and rental property shoots. Using 10-shot bracketed HDR composite photographs, you are sure to get natural photos of your space. Looking through their portfolio, you’ll see that both the interior staging and the outdoor view are perfectly exposed.
As a full-service studio, they have dedicated photo editing specialists who carefully go over each image by hand for quality. If you want to work with professionals who understand the art of photography and the art of selling with photos, the pros at Snap2Close are here for you.

6. Ensure stunning images of your home from every angle when you hire Camille Skousen
Camille Skousen is a Phoenix real estate photographer specializing in diverse packages and high-dynamic range photography. Her photo sets include options for virtual staging and twilight, either real or virtual, to add extra interest to the home. All of her package options contribute to getting a sale. As an FAA-certified drone pilot, she is current on the current rules and regulations of getting those jaw-dropping aerial shots. Plus, her video home tours will help you stand out from the crowd.
7. Showcase the luxury aspects of your space with images by AZ Panorama
Serving the greater Phoenix metro area with his beautiful photos, Reid Helms of AZ Panorama helps you capture what is special about your property. He is also an accomplished landscape photographer who brings elements of your carefully curated landscape into your real estate photos. We love how this makes them a feature instead of just a background.
His high-end editing is perfect for spacious homes — erasing any shadows and accentuating the loftiness of high ceilings. Everything about Reid’s style is luxurious, from the homes he photographs to how he photographs them. Therefore, he is a particularly good choice for developers who want to command top dollar for their designs.
